To ask the Minister for Jobs, Enterprise and Innovation his policy on a code of practice for the grocery goods sector;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[37435/12]
Richard Bruton (Dublin North Central,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
The Programme for Government contains a specific commitment to enact legislation to regulate certain practices in the grocery goods sector. I intend to give effect to this commitment by including an enabling provision in the legislation currently being prepared by the Office of the Parliamentary Counsel to merge the National Consumer Agency and the Competition Authority, which will allow for the introduction of a statutory Code of Practice in the grocery goods sector. It is hoped to publish this legislation before the end of the year.
